Diane Salinger
Biography
Diane Louise Salinger, born on January 25, 1951, is a talented American actress and voice performer celebrated for her unique character portrayals in film, television, and theater. She first garnered significant attention for her compelling role as Apollonia in HBO's acclaimed series "Carnivàle," which aired from 2003 to 2005. Salinger has also made her mark in cinema with memorable performances in iconic films such as "Pee-wee's Big Adventure," Tim Burton's "Batman Returns," and "Ghost World."
Her extensive television repertoire showcases her versatility, featuring appearances in hit series like "Curb Your Enthusiasm," "ER," "Star Trek: Deep Space Nine," and "Law & Order." Salinger's ability to inhabit diverse roles has made her a respected figure in the entertainment industry.
